与多个用户共享Access 2016数据库可以通过以下几种方式实现:
- 使用前端/后端架构:将数据库拆分为前端和后端两部分。前端部分包含用户界面和数据输入/输出逻辑,后端部分包含实际的数据库文件。多个用户可以通过前端应用程序连接到后端数据库,实现共享访问。这种架构可以使用各种编程语言和框架来实现,如Java、Python、C#等。腾讯云提供的云服务器(CVM)和云数据库MySQL可以作为后端部分的解决方案。
- 使用数据库服务器:将Access 2016数据库迁移到支持多用户共享的数据库服务器,如MySQL、SQL Server等。这些数据库服务器提供了并发访问控制和事务管理等功能,可以支持多个用户同时访问和修改数据库。腾讯云提供的云数据库MySQL和云数据库SQL Server可以作为这种解决方案的选择。
- 使用云原生数据库:云原生数据库是一种在云环境下设计和部署的数据库服务,具有高可用性、弹性扩展和自动管理等特点。腾讯云提供的云原生数据库TDSQL(MySQL版)和TDSQL(PostgreSQL版)可以作为多用户共享Access 2016数据库的替代方案。
无论选择哪种方式,都需要考虑以下几点:
- 并发控制:确保多个用户同时访问数据库时不会发生冲突和数据损坏。可以使用锁机制、事务管理和乐观并发控制等技术来实现。
- 安全性:保护数据库中的数据不被未经授权的用户访问和修改。可以使用访问控制、身份验证和加密等措施来提高数据库的安全性。
- 性能优化:针对多用户共享的场景,需要优化数据库的性能,提高响应速度和并发处理能力。可以使用索引、查询优化和缓存等技术来提升数据库性能。
腾讯云相关产品和产品介绍链接地址: